Build end-to-end streaming pipelines with Amazon Managed Service for Apache Flink Blueprints with a single click. Learn more.
Documentation
Check out the Developer Guides for Amazon Managed Service for Apache Flink and Amazon Managed Service for Apache Flink Studio.
Developer Guide for Apache Flink Applications
The Developer Guide for Amazon Managed Service for Apache Flink describes how to build and run real-time streaming applications using Apache Flink in Java, Scala, and Python, with your choice of interactive developer environment.
Developer Guide for Amazon Managed Apache Flink Studio
The Developer Guide for Amazon Managed Service for Apache Flink Studio describes how to build Apache Flink applications in SQL, Python, and Scala in an interactive notebook interface.
Tools and SDKs
The following are tools and SDKs for Amazon Managed Service for Apache Flink and Amazon Managed Service for Apache Flink Studio.
API reference
The Developer Guide for Amazon Managed Service for Apache Flink describes how to build and run real-time streaming applications using Apache Flink in Java, Scala, and Python, with your choice of interactive developer environment.
Workshops
The following are workshops for Amazon Managed Service for Apache Flink and Amazon Managed Service for Apache Flink Studio.
Local development with Apache Flink
This workshop shows you the basics of getting started on locally developing Apache Flink applications with the goal of deploying to Amazon Managed Service for Apache Flink.
Event detection with Amazon Managed Service for Apache Flink Studio
In this workshop, you will create a stream processing application using Amazon Managed Service for Apache Flink Studio to identify customers entering your casino who are betting big, and the stream processing application sends you an email when big spenders sit down at a gambling table. You will also identify tables that need a refill on chips and identify potential cheaters in your casino through their betting and winning patterns
Getting Started
Dive deep into these workshops for Apache Flink and Apache Beam on Amazon Managed Service for Apache Flink and Amazon Managed Service for Apache Flink Studio. They all use the New York City taxi cab trips dataset.
Getting started with Apache Flink »
Getting started with Apache Beam »
Getting started with Amazon Managed Service for Apache Flink Studio »
AWS Solution Briefs
Explore AWS solutions for Amazon Managed Service for Apache Flink.
Blog posts
We have a rich set of blog articles that provide use case and best practices guidance to help you get the most out of the service. Access our full list of blog articles through the resources below.
Read more Amazon Managed Service for Apache Flink articles on the AWS News Blog.
Learn about best practices, feature capabilities, and customer use cases on the AWS Big Data Blog.
Read more blog articles about Amazon Kinesis on the AWS Databases Blog.
Videos
Watch AWS videos about Amazon Managed Service for Apache Flink.
Learn how Poshmark enhanced user experience by designing real-time personalization using real-time event capture with Amazon Managed Service for Apache Kafka (Amazon MSK) and real-time data enrichment with Amazon Managed Service for Apache Flink.
Learn how Samsung SmartThings moved from self-managed Apache Spark to a fully managed stream processing platform with Amazon Managed Service for Apache Flink. Additionally, learn how Samsung SmartThings securely streamed data at scale with fully managed Amazon Kinesis Data Streams and Amazon MSK.
Dive deep on the advantages of, the convenience of, and more details on using AWS Identity and Access Management (IAM) with Amazon MSK. With Amazon Managed Service for Apache Flink, you can build stream processing applications in multiple languages, including SQL.
Learn how Amazon Managed Service for Apache Flink Studio simplifies querying data streams using SQL, Python, or Scala. A managed Apache Zeppelin notebook-based development environment and stream processing powered by Apache Flink lets you quickly analyze streaming data from a variety of sources including Kinesis Data Streams and Amazon MSK.
Get started with Amazon Kinesis Data Analytics
Instantly get access to the AWS Free Tier.
Learn how to use Amazon Kinesis Data Analytics in the step-by-step guide for Apache Flink and Amazon Kinesis Data Analytics Studio.
Build your streaming application from the Amazon Kinesis Data Analytics console.